ca4daa1539 feat: group SSH config directives with trade-off explanations
SSH config hardening now presents directives in logical groups
(matching the git config UX) with reasoning for each:
- Host Verification: TOFU rationale, known_hosts exfiltration risk
- Key & Agent Management: key enumeration attack, passphrase fatigue
- Algorithm Restrictions: downgrade attack, intentional RSA breakage

Each group batches its directives into a single prompt instead of
asking one-by-one.

apply_ssh_directive_group "Host Verification" \
"Trust-on-first-use (TOFU): accept new host keys automatically, but reject
changed keys (the actual MITM scenario). The default 'ask' just trains users
to blindly type 'yes'. Hashing known_hosts prevents hostname enumeration if
the file is exfiltrated." \
"StrictHostKeyChecking" "accept-new" "Auto-accept new hosts, reject changed keys" \
"HashKnownHosts" "yes" "Hash hostnames in known_hosts (privacy)"
apply_ssh_directive_group "Key & Agent Management" \
"Without IdentitiesOnly, ssh-agent offers ALL loaded keys to every server —
a malicious server can enumerate which services you have access to.
AddKeysToAgent reduces passphrase fatigue so developers actually use them." \
"IdentitiesOnly" "yes" "Only offer keys explicitly configured (prevents key leakage)" \
"AddKeysToAgent" "yes" "Auto-add keys to ssh-agent after first use"
apply_ssh_directive_group "Algorithm Restrictions" \
"Disables RSA and DSA negotiation entirely. This prevents downgrade attacks
to weaker algorithms. May break connections to legacy servers that only
support RSA — those servers should be upgraded (RSA-SHA1 deprecated since
OpenSSH 8.7)." \
"PubkeyAcceptedAlgorithms" "ssh-ed25519,sk-ssh-ed25519@openssh.com,ecdsa-sha2-nistp256,sk-ecdsa-sha2-nistp256@openssh.com" \
"Ed25519 + ECDSA (software and hardware-backed)"
